Discover a local farmers market

Locally grown foods are not only beneficial for the environment, they’re often a lot fresher and cheaper too. Then, there’s the added bonus of supporting local businesses.

Make an effort this week to find out where and when your community’s next local farmers’ market takes place. Plan a trip.

I love my local farmer’s market that’s been around over 100 years. Bartlett’s farm on Nantucket Island is wonderful. They grow organic greens, veggies, flower and plants, and import other produce. They have a great selection of cheeses, olives, meats and have a bakery and fresh deli/prepared foods. They are like a mini whole foods market. I love supporting a local farm that has been such a huge part of the local economy and history of this island. :) http://www.bartlettsfarm.com
